Output 5abb24beb046ab755b31b68419f92ab8383007a5ee0e20a134469f9e24cbec63:9

value
20032
script pubkey
OP_0 OP_PUSHBYTES_20 8ecb82a0120199aee6b44301cd8de328730ae500
address
bc1q3m9c9gqjqxv6ae45gvqumr0r9pes4egql73zxn
transaction
5abb24beb046ab755b31b68419f92ab8383007a5ee0e20a134469f9e24cbec63
confirmations
85027
spent
true